Output 785b536d76a3921ef825ee99b2f1e5487023640650869bcb8405beb19c8456ce:8

value
3368531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d6093bcacd6fccae05e95f3096f9e3624c91077 OP_EQUAL
address
3JxML6QmwMEtwqqgFRJ4gGXZqNzrXEpoq2
transaction
785b536d76a3921ef825ee99b2f1e5487023640650869bcb8405beb19c8456ce
spent
true